Output c064d184231a17c67f5194a9fc11e05c3b596a54b9258454a4686fd24174c6ae:0

value
57606918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4c37098c8f53bb5fc3137f771d6b343c639bb37 OP_EQUAL
address
3JAogUFvu4XAkyfHXLEhncXtq1ckFp9aiC
transaction
c064d184231a17c67f5194a9fc11e05c3b596a54b9258454a4686fd24174c6ae
confirmations
318598
spent
true